Been doing a bit more fabrication to one of my mates hayabusa drag bike thats already doing a quarter mile in 7.3 sec, he tells me he needs to cool the air down as we all know the colder the air the more we can ram in and the faser we go , and before you say god damm them badboys look ugly... yes they do but it aint all about looks when your winning races,
So heres a few selected pics i took.
Ill let you all know how much faster it makes it go in spring time.

Cheers for the comments lads , yeah I've even said it will probably take off or at least start lifting, but apparently it with cool the air by half and he will be able to turn the boost down to around 15 / 16 as its running well over 20 at over 600 brake the mo, so less strain on the motor , time will tell eh, ill keep you updated when he does a few runs .
